Asbestos Trust Funds

Asbestos trust funds are large sums of money asbestos companies have set aside to compensate those who have been diagnosed with mesothelioma and other asbestos-related diseases. These trusts are meant to ensure that all victims who are eligible receive compensation for their ailments that could include funeral costs and restitution for pain and suffering.

After declaring bankruptcy, companies that produce asbestos are required to set up trusts. They do this to protect themselves from litigation ongoing and to allow them to liquidate or settle certain claims they have received from mesothelioma sufferers.

In the majority of cases, victims must prove their exposure to asbestos in order to be eligible for gwwa.yodev.net the benefits of mesothelioma funds. This can involve providing details of the work history and medical records to prove how the asbestos-related disease was identified and the extent to which the victim was exposed to the company's products. Your lawyer will assist you gather all this information and choose which trust to make a claim against.

To compensate asbestos victims, there's estimated to be $30 billion in asbestos trusts. Some asbestos victims may have to file multiple claims to be able to receive the compensation they deserve.

Each asbestos trust has its own process for reviewing and paying, as well as its own guidelines for eligibility. Settlements

A lawsuit may be filed by people diagnosed with mesothelioma or asbestosis, along with other asbestos-related illnesses. Mesothelioma settlements are more quick to be awarded than a verdict and offer victims the opportunity to receive compensation fast so that they can get medical treatment that could prolong their lives. Mesothelioma Settlements hold companies accountable, since they must admit that their products caused harm to their victims, and pay for the damages they caused.

Lawsuits filed on behalf of victims can take a long time to resolve. The amount that is awarded will depend on the particulars of each case, including mesothelioma-related symptoms and the degree of exposure. Mesothelioma settlements tend to be reached outside of court because defendants understand that the life expectancy of their victims is limited and they need compensation to live comfortably.

The process begins with identifying the companies that are responsible for asbestos exposure. Then, lawyers from both sides work together to discuss settlement options. Once a settlement has been reached, the defendants will need to sign their own authorizations before the finance department of the attorney can issue the settlement. The money is typically deposited in the trust account.

Asbestos victims who are awarded settlements could be eligible to receive compensatory damages such as future and past medical expenses and emotional distress, lost income as well as pain and suffering, and loss of enjoyment of life's activities. The award of punitive damages is not often granted, but can be if there is evidence that the defendants are guilty of negligent actions. Lawsuits for wrongful death

Asbestos victims and their families can get compensation from a variety of sources. For example a wrongful death lawsuit can help pay funeral expenses, final medical bills, and even the loss of future income. In addition, wrongful death lawsuits could provide financial security to the survivors of mesothelioma patients' family.

Wrongful death lawsuits are civil lawsuits filed by relatives and friends against companies or individuals who were accountable for exposure to asbestos. A claim for wrongful deaths must establish negligence and/or a direct link between the asbestos exposure and the subsequent diagnosis of an asbestos-related disease like mesothelioma or asbestosis or lung cancer.

Mesothelioma wrongful death settlements typically contain monetary awards to compensate surviving loved ones for the costs incurred by the death of the victim including funeral and burial costs medical bills, loss of income as well as pain, suffering and much more. A wrongful-death suit could also hold a defendant accountable for the emotional and mental distress experienced by surviving loved one following the victim's passing.

Like other personal injury cases, a mesothelioma lawsuit for wrongful death may be determined by a judge or jury, or Vimeo.Com settled outside of court. Settlement amounts are generally agreed upon by all parties to the case.

The mesothelioma settlement average is between $1 and $2 million. It can differ, based on the circumstances of the case and the severity of the damages suffered by the family or victim. Health Insurance Options

Compensation for mesothelioma may help families and victims pay for medical expenses that are associated with the cancer. It is not the only option to pay for treatment. Patients with mesothelioma and their loved ones can also look into additional financial options like insurance, government programs and private charitable organizations.

Mesothelioma patients who have health insurance provided by employers insurance may receive treatment free or at a lower price than those without insurance. Employers buy health coverage in bulk, which allows them to offer better rates than what individuals can get on their own. Many mesothelioma lawyers assist clients to obtain these benefits.

Medicare can be used to pay for treatment of mesothelioma. Certain states have health plans that bridge the gap between what Medicare covers and what a patient needs. Patients may also be able to qualify for Medicaid in the event that they have a low income and suffer from mesothelioma.

Even if someone is insured, the nature of their illness could result in significant costs. Patients are required to pay deductibles and copays each year before insurance starts to take effect. In addition, specific treatments such as immunotherapy may cost thousands of dollars each month, which adds quickly.
